trading time ?

a time bank is a kind of exchange club for work : you help each other with tasks or services, and you get paid in 'time credits' : for example, half an hour helping someone move, an hour of piano lessons, two hours of babysitting

it works like a marketplace, but one that's just for help and services : this makes it easier to help each other, in your neighbourhood or even across a whole region : there are already time banks like timebank.cc in the hague, lets in leiden, and makkie in amsterdam

but the problem is : every time bank has its own system, which means you can only exchange within your own group : that's why the workbank is introducing a new exchange currency

worknotes !

worknotes is an exchange currency, like the euro, but based on time : there are notes for 30 minutes, 1 hour, 2 hours, or even 5 hours

how does it work?
1 : you help someone with a task
2 : you receive worknotes for the time you spent
3 : need help yourself? pay with your worknotes

worknotes can be used at all time banks, organisations, and businesses that participate

how can i get worknotes ?

what are the ways to get worknotes?

  • offer a service : sign up at a local time bank and offer what you can do
  • volunteering : help at a participating volunteer organisation and receive worknotes
  • buying worknotes : at the workbank you will be able to buy worknotes at the average hourly wage
  • a loan : at some time banks you will be able to borrow worknotes and earn them back later by offering services yourself

faq

frequently asked questions about the concept

what if you can't spend your worknotes ?

if you do a lot of jobs but don't need much help yourself, you can end up saving a lot of worknotes : what do you do with them ? in that situation there are several options

  • you can of course always choose to donate them to others or to the local community (time bank)
  • if there is an agreement with a local volunteer organisation, it may be possible to exchange worknotes for a volunteer contribution
  • the local time bank may have a scheme to exchange worknotes, for example for euros or vouchers for local businesses

who is behind this initiative ?

worknotes is an initiative of today art foundation : in the 1980s they set up a time bank for the first time, called the werkbank, but back then the time was not yet right : since then the popularity of time banks has grown, and today art foundation wants to give the werkbank a second chance : this time not just locally, but to connect existing time banks with a universal currency, worknotes : to create a solidarity economy where no one ever has to be unemployed : if you want, you can always work for someone and receive worknotes in return
